Summary
If you make 1,144,780 kr a year living in the region of Aarhus, Denmark, you will be taxed 458,075 kr. That means that your net pay will be 686,705 kr per year, or 57,225 kr per month. Your average tax rate is 40.0% and your marginal tax rate is 48.2%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of 100 kr in your salary will be taxed 48.17 kr, hence, your net pay will only increase by 51.83 kr.
Bonus Example
A 1,000 kr bonus will generate an extra 518 kr of net incomes. A 5,000 kr bonus will generate an extra 2,592 kr of net incomes.
